22 <br /> <br />a) CALL TO ORDER <br />The meeting of the Council shall be called to order by the Mayor or in his/her <br />absence by the Vice Mayor. In the absence of both the Mayor and the Vice <br />Mayor, the meeting shall be called to order by the City Clerk, after that the City <br />Clerk shall immediately call for the selection of a temporary Presiding Officer. <br />b) PARTICIPATION BY PRESIDING OFFICER <br />The Presiding Officer may move, second, and debate from the Chair, subject <br />only to such limitations of debate as are imposed on all Council Members, and <br />he/she shall not be deprived of any of the rights and privileges of a Council <br />Member because of his/her acting as Presiding Officer. However, the Presiding <br />Officer is primarily responsible for the conduct of the meeting. If he/she desires to <br />engage in extended debate on questions before the Council personally, he/she <br />should consider turning the Chair over to another member. <br />c) QUESTION TO BE STATED <br />The Presiding Officer shall orally restate each question immediately before the <br />call for the vote. Following the vote, the Presiding Officer or City Clerk shall <br />announce whether the question carried or was defeated for the benefit of the <br />audience. <br /> <br />MAINTENANCE OF ORDER <br />The Presiding Officer is responsible for the maintenance of order and decorum at all <br />times. No Councilmember, staff or member of the audience is allowed to speak who <br />has not first been recognized by the Chair. All questions and remarks shall be <br />addressed to the Chair. <br /> <br />The Presiding Officer shall ensure that he/she, as well as the balance of Council, <br />refrains from commenting or entering into conversation with speakers during Public <br />Comments or during Public Hearings. <br /> <br />PROCESSION OF MOTIONS <br />When a motion is made and seconded, it shall be stated by the Presiding <br />Officer before debate. A motion so stated shall not be withdrawn by the <br />maker without the consent of the person seconding it. <br /> <br />BUSINESS ITEMS OUT OF ORDER <br />The Presiding Officer may at any time, by majority consent of the Council, <br />permit a member to move an ordinance, resolution, or motion out of the <br />regular agenda order. <br /> <br />DIVISION OF QUESTION <br />If the question contains two or more division-able propositions, the Presiding <br />Officer may, upon request of a member, (unless appealed) divide the same. <br /> <br />Exhibit A <br />Resolution No. 2026-021 Page 68
